Hi all.

I'm trying to debug MIMXRT685-AUD-EVK board for using customized voip library.

So I added customized voip library(about 920KB) to \devices\MIMXRT685S\xtensa\gdbio\ folder

and some DSP codes to xa-capturer-dmic.c's xa_hw_capturer_read_FIFO().

Debug and run on Xtensa Xplorer IDE, I can see error message on xt-ocd daemon window like below.

 

Spoiler
Error: Exception!
Error: Exception details: exccause:0xd, excvaddr:0x428a0038, epc:0x1cfe04, epcdbg:2402063c
Error: Op 'xtensa_read_memory' failed, will not retry
ERROR: Command 'm428a0038,4' failed!
Error: Exception!
Error: Exception details: exccause:0xd, excvaddr:0x428a0038, epc:0x240205bc, epcdbg:2402063c
Error: Op 'xtensa_read_memory' failed, will not retry
ERROR: Command 'm428a0038,4' failed!
Error: Exception!
Error: Exception details: exccause:0xd, excvaddr:0x428a0030, epc:0x240205bc, epcdbg:2402063c

 

 

<Development Enviroment>

PC: window 10

EVK: MIMXRT685-AUD-EVK

SDK: dsp_xaf_record_hifi4

MCUXpresso v11.5.1

Xtensa OCD Daemon v14.08

Xtensa Xplorer v9.0.18

 

<Compiled DSP bin Size>

    dsp_data_debug.bin: 1153KB

    dsp_ncache_debug.bin: 11KB

    dsp_text_debug.bin: 130KB

 

<Error Message: below image>

xtensa_error.PNG

 

please let me know if more information is needed or how can I fixed this error.

Hello Gnani,

XOCD log shows the access to memory location 0x428a0038 failed with a data error resulting in exception to get triggered.

system memory map is included in linker support packages, pls ref to elf32xtensa.x under ldscripts folder
